The well-known K-pop girl group remains on pause as a legal conflict with their management label drags on. This dispute has garnered significant attention in South Korea, where entertainment companies wield considerable power over their artists.
Earlier today, the label revealed that two members — Haerin and Hyein — are gearing up for a return to the K-pop industry. However, it stopped short of confirming the participation of the remaining three members in future activities.
“We are currently assessing whether the three members wish to rejoin,” the agency stated in an email.
This legal turmoil began earlier this year when the group initiated legal action against the label, citing mistreatment and requesting the termination of their contracts. In March, a South Korean court granted an injunction that prevented the group from taking on independent ventures while the lawsuit is ongoing.
The ruling permitted the label to retain complete management control over the group and barred the five members from engaging in any commercial or promotional endeavors without the label’s approval.
As the legal battle progresses, fans are left wondering about the group’s future and whether all members will reunite under the same management.
